Skip to content
Change the repository type filter

All

    Repositories list

    • Definitions from the Virtual I/O Device (VIRTIO) specification.
      Rust
      42800Updated Jan 26, 2026Jan 26, 2026
    • uefi-rs

      Public
      Rusty wrapper for the Unified Extensible Firmware Interface (UEFI). This crate makes it easy to develop Rust software that leverages safe, convenient, and performant abstractions for UEFI functionality.
      Rust
      1871.5k298Updated Jan 26, 2026Jan 26, 2026
    • homepage

      Public
      CSS
      38142143Updated Jan 25, 2026Jan 25, 2026
    • Rust
      123711Updated Jan 21, 2026Jan 21, 2026
    • x86_64

      Public
      Library to program x86_64 hardware.
      Rust
      152908227Updated Jan 16, 2026Jan 16, 2026
    • An experimental pure-Rust x86 bootloader
      Rust
      2271.6k795Updated Jan 13, 2026Jan 13, 2026
    • bootimage

      Public
      Tool to create bootable disk images from a Rust OS kernel.
      Rust
      67871171Updated Jan 10, 2026Jan 10, 2026
    • Rusty wrappers for Multiboot2.
      Rust
      5712621Updated Jan 1, 2026Jan 1, 2026
    • Automatically cross-compiles the sysroot crates core, compiler_builtins, and alloc.
      Rust
      99268141Updated Dec 5, 2025Dec 5, 2025
    • .github

      Public
      About this organization
      313200Updated Dec 2, 2025Dec 2, 2025
    • Cross-architecture, no-std memory barriers.
      Rust
      0500Updated Dec 2, 2025Dec 2, 2025
    • pci_types

      Public
      Useful types for dealing with PCI
      Rust
      153430Updated Nov 29, 2025Nov 29, 2025
    • acpi

      Public
      Rust library for parsing ACPI tables and interpreting AML
      Rust
      752312813Updated Oct 19, 2025Oct 19, 2025
    • Minimal support for uart_16550 serial output.
      Rust
      274354Updated Jul 24, 2025Jul 24, 2025
    • Byte-order-aware numeric types.
      Rust
      01200Updated Oct 13, 2024Oct 13, 2024
    • fuse-abi

      Public
      FUSE device bindings.
      Rust
      0500Updated Oct 13, 2024Oct 13, 2024
    • Rudimentary ieee1275/OpenFirmware Rust environment similar to uefi-rs.
      Rust
      2600Updated Sep 9, 2024Sep 9, 2024
    • xhci

      Public
      A Rust library which is useful to handle xHCI
      Rust
      94673Updated Sep 2, 2024Sep 2, 2024
    • ucs2-rs

      Public
      UCS-2 conversion utilities for Rust.
      Rust
      4810Updated Jul 30, 2024Jul 30, 2024
    • volatile

      Public
      Rust
      199230Updated Jun 6, 2024Jun 6, 2024
    • Rust
      5223891Updated May 30, 2024May 30, 2024
    • pic8259

      Public
      Rust
      81501Updated Mar 11, 2024Mar 11, 2024
    • A simple spinlock crate based on the abstractions provided by the `lock_api` crate.
      Rust
      44300Updated Oct 19, 2023Oct 19, 2023
    • vga

      Public
      Library to program vga hardware.
      Rust
      156042Updated Jun 12, 2023Jun 12, 2023
    • usb

      Public
      Utilities for working with USB devices
      Rust
      0600Updated Sep 12, 2022Sep 12, 2022
    • ansi_rgb

      Public
      Colorful terminal text using ANSI escape sequences
      Rust
      51500Updated Jun 25, 2022Jun 25, 2022
    • ps2-mouse

      Public
      Library to manage a PS2 mouse
      Rust
      71321Updated Aug 30, 2021Aug 30, 2021
    • apic

      Public
      Rust
      31621Updated Sep 21, 2020Sep 21, 2020
    • x86_64_types

      Public archive
      Rust
      1610Updated May 3, 2019May 3, 2019
    • os_bootinfo

      Public archive
      Rust
      3610Updated Aug 16, 2018Aug 16, 2018